Output c131869c71f02174455b1e9c16283fd9b1d9dda101a6943ea9a66f5f3e1d5bec: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db94b8eb7ace6bbeacc2cc28efb6fec2c89e94c OP_EQUAL
address
3LSnRQEoPi28oHb1u6zFF5XUqXkzkwUVNb
transaction
c131869c71f02174455b1e9c16283fd9b1d9dda101a6943ea9a66f5f3e1d5bec
confirmations
422779
spent
true